Our area is high desert but gets freezing temperatures. It's very rural and we have many wild herbivores that visit the campus. The middle school kids who make up the start up crew for the garden will be learning not only scientific skills which go with gardens, but they will also learn about landscape design, creating structures that are stable and long lasting, and how to use basic tools and building concepts. A prepared garden is one thing, but one that you have built yourself and can see where your efforts have paid off or where you learned from a mistake in order to do a better job, that is entirely different. These children deserve a chance to build a legacy that they will have access to for as long as they attend this school. In some cases that is another 6 years. It is intended to be a learning garden but also to provide food options and hopefully donations to low income households in our area.
